Budapest, the capital city of Hungary, is a vibrant and historic destination known for its stunning architecture, rich culture, and thermal baths. It is often referred to as the 'Pearl of the Danube' due to its picturesque location on the banks of the Danube River. With its blend of old-world charm and modern attractions, Budapest offers visitors a unique and unforgettable travel experience.

  1. Budapest

    Explore the iconic Buda Castle, which dates back to the 13th century and is a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Highlights include the Hungarian National Gallery and the Matthias Church.

    120 minutes sightseeing history Google Maps
  2. Budapest

    Relax in one of Budapest's most famous thermal baths, Széchenyi. With a variety of indoor and outdoor pools, saunas, and steam rooms, it is the perfect place to unwind and experience a unique aspect of Hungarian culture.

    180 minutes wellness culture Google Maps
  3. Budapest

    Browse the colorful stalls of the Great Market Hall and sample some traditional Hungarian dishes, such as goulash and lángos. You can also purchase local crafts and souvenirs.

    90 minutes foodhunt culture Google Maps

  1. Budapest

    Take a guided tour of the Hungarian Parliament Building, which is one of the most impressive landmarks in Budapest. You will learn about its history and architecture, and get to see the Crown Jewels.

    120 minutes sightseeing history Google Maps
  2. Budapest

    Wander around the vibrant Jewish Quarter, which is known for its ruin bars, street art, and Jewish heritage. You can visit the Great Synagogue and the Jewish Museum to learn more about the community.

    180 minutes sightseeing culture Google Maps
  3. Budapest

    Enjoy panoramic views of Budapest from the Fisherman's Bastion, a stunning neo-Gothic structure located on Castle Hill. You can also admire the seven towers and the Matthias Church.

    90 minutes sightseeing skyline Google Maps

Accommodation

hostel
15-30 USD per person per night
hotel
100-250 USD per room per night
airbnb
50-150 USD per night

Transportation

subway
0.80 USD per ride
taxi
1.2-1.5 USD per km
Uber
1.2-1.5 USD per km
bicycle rental
10-15 USD per day
walking tour
15-25 USD per person

Food

budget restaurants
5-10 USD per meal
street food
2-5 USD per food item
mid-range restaurants
15-30 USD per person per meal
fancier restaurants
50-100 USD per person per meal
local markets
10-20 USD for a variety items for cooking

Activities

walking tour
15-25 USD per person
visit to thermal baths
15-25 USD per person
entrance fee to Buda Castle
10-15 USD per person
river cruise
15-30 USD per person
wine tasting tours
50-100 USD per person
